Living Stone

Thank you Lord for allowing Peter to fail For times when my spirit is weak and frail Thank you Lord for fire warmed denial For times when I break down under trial Thank you Lord for Peter's fear, his guilt, and shame For I too have often carried those names Thank you Lord for his objection to your plans For times that I am a proud stubborn man Thank you Lord for a long night of emptiness In order that you overflow our nets Thank you my Lord, my Love, for a love reclaimed As you beckon my love again, again In all these failures, I see him, I see me And you respond with unfailing Mercy And if you still want him, you can still want me I can offer my life fully, freely For if he is the rock hewn for eternity Please Lord carve a living stone from me

Unleashed

Unleashed

And now fifty days since Salvation wrought
Heavenly Volley overflows their court.

Eleven bound in wood, fear, and doubt
Only Love can conjure the single way out.

Flame descends, incinerates what binds
Laps courage in timid heart, soul, and mind.

Like their Master they burst their tomb
Like their Master, their tomb a new womb.

Flames forge within; Love consumes all fear
The Good News molded to alien ear.

Heavenly arson hurled down to unite
One Bread, One Body, One Church, one CHRIST.

The fallen arise, Paradise within reach
Universe anew; Upper room unleashed.

Precious

Luke 15:11-32 

In search of delight, I wandered away
Exchanged my inheritance for nothing at all.

Choking on filth, suffocating in sin
I drew one last breath, and dared venture home.

Upon my knees with pod stained cheeks
When from afar you beckoned me near.

You ringed me and robed me, welcomed me home
Cleansed and clutched me, claimed me your own.

With open side, you slay me forgiven
With tender gaze, you tended my wounds
With pierced hands, you slaked me Precious

Your Mercy; my treasure
Your Name; my inheritance
Your Word; my path
Your Kingdom; my home.


"This brother of yours was dead and is alive again; he was lost and is found."

Simple Soul

A simple soul desires simple things,
health, family, and favor from God.

A simple soul prays a simple prayer,
Thy will be done, with all its might.

A simple soul performs simple acts, 
the task at hand, the duty of vocation.

A simple soul offers simple means,
an open mind, a heart to be stirred.

A simple soul follows the simple Way,
with a supple will, upon its knees
waiting to be moved.

A simple soul has a simple design,
thread with thanksgiving, 
and patterned with praise, 

A simple soul displays a simple trust,
like a child, in the Providence of God.

A simple soul
simply lives its life
simply gives its life
for the glory of God.

Portent

Whisper to me
I can't hear you when you scream
rescue me
engulfed in that scream.

Whisper to me
like the portent of the Omnipotent
upon the still small breeze

calms the chaos, quells the cacophony
gently surrenders the ear.

Saving whisper, attune my ear to truth.
Giving whisper, poise my mind for beauty.
Merciful whisper, dispose my soul to goodness.

Because a whisper, oh, a whisper!

Anything worth giving
anything worth receiving

should be 
born of 
a whisper.
